Abstract
Background The quantification and interpretation of cardiorespiratory fitness (CRF) in obesity is important for adequately assessing cardiovascular conditioning, underlying comorbidities, and properly evaluating disease risk. We retrospectively compared peak oxygen uptake (o2peak) (ie, CRF) in absolute terms, and relative terms (% predicted) using three currently suggested prediction equations (Equations R, W, and G).
